Event Description
The customer observed falsely elevated magnesium results generated on the architect c16000 processing module for two samples that were not released out of the lab.The following results were provided: (b)(6) original result = 3.6671 mmol/l, repeat result = 0.9396 mmol/l (b)(6) original result = >3.9 mmol/l, repeat result = 0.9196 mmol/l reference (normal) ranges: 0.66 to 1.07 mmol/l no impact to patient management was reported.

Manufacturer Narrative
The complaint investigation for falsely elevated magnesium results included a review of data and information provided by the customer, search for similar complaints, ticket trending review, labeling review, and device history record review.Return testing was not completed as returns were not available.A review of tracking and trending did not identify any trends for the issue for the product.Device history record review did not identify any non-conformances or deviations with the complaint lot.Labeling was reviewed and sufficiently addresses the customer's issue.Based on the investigation, no systemic issue or deficiency with the architect magnesium reagent kit, lot number 51199ud00, was identified.The following sections have been corrected to reflect the current contact (b)(6): g1-contact office first name g1-contact office last name g1-contact office address 1 g1-contact office city g1-contact office postal code g1-contact office country g1-contact office phone number g1-contact office email g1-contact office fax number.
